Overview

Recombinant human angiostatin is a recombinant protein corresponding to the internal kringle domains (typically kringles 1–3 or 1–4) of human plasminogen that functions as a potent endogenous inhibitor of angiogenesis and tumor growth.[2][4][8][14] Produced in expression systems such as Pichia pastoris, it selectively targets proliferating microvascular endothelial cells, inhibiting their proliferation, migration, tube formation, and neovascularization, thereby suppressing primary and metastatic tumor growth in preclinical models.[2][4][8][14] Mechanistically, angiostatin binds to endothelial cell surface receptors including the catalytic subunit of ATP synthase and signaling hubs near focal adhesion kinase, disrupting extracellular ATP generation, integrin/FAK signaling, and downstream pathways that support angiogenesis within the tumor microenvironment.[4] In early-phase clinical trials, systemically administered recombinant human angiostatin as a continuous or twice-daily subcutaneous infusion showed acceptable safety, rapid clearance, and pharmacokinetics consistent with its short plasma half-life, and was explored alone or in combination with paclitaxel/carboplatin in advanced solid tumors such as non–small cell lung cancer.[4][11][12][13]
